有没有什么技巧可以让 Firefox 的 Devtools(开发人员工具)调试器使用键盘暂停 JavaScript?

有没有什么技巧可以让 Firefox 的 Devtools(开发人员工具)调试器使用键盘暂停 JavaScript?

当 Firefox Devtools(开发人员工具)调试器窗格打开时,您应该能够按F8键盘键来暂停 JavaScript。

我发现这在复杂的网站上很少起作用(在 Stack Exchange 和 StackOverflow 等简单网站上可以正常工作)。通常,我让 Firefox 暂停的唯一方法是使用指点设备(轨迹球、鼠标等)单击pauseFirefox Devtools GUI 中的按钮。这样做的问题是它需要将光标从 Web 浏览器视口中移除,这会导致 HTML 元素失去焦点。

是否有一个技巧/秘密可以让 Firefox Devtools 调试器使用键盘暂停?

答案1

由于@andrybak 的评论确实帮助我做到了这一点,我会将其添加为完整的答案。

  1. 打开您的网站并转到您想要检查工具提示或其他鼠标相关事件的页面/情况。
  2. 在 Firefox 中打开开发者工具并转到调试器选项卡。(在 Chrome 中称为来源)现在导航
  3. 打开‘事件监听器断点’
  4. 按“鼠标”进行过滤(如下所示)
  5. 选择“click”,或者如果触发频率太高,则选择“dblclick”表示双击。
  6. 转到您的网站并触发事件(使用工具提示将鼠标悬停在您的元素上)。
  7. 现在调试器将会中断并且您可以检查您的站点。

在此处输入图片描述

相关内容